GloRilla’s ‘Wanna Be’ may have been one of her biggest Hot 100 songs to date, but according to a recent lawsuit filed by fellow rapper Plies, the song could end up in court.

According to documents acquired by TMZ, Plies (born Algernod Washington) is suing GloRilla for ‘Wanna Be,’ stating that the song violates the copyright of his 2004 song ‘Me & My Goons.’GloRilla Biography, Age, Wiki, Instagram, Songs, Albums, Boyfriend, Net Worth, and Career

Because Megan Thee Stallion and Cardi B are listed as features on the official remix of the Glo cut, the ‘WAP‘ hitmakers have also been named defendants in the suit.  Even Soulja Boy, whose 2010 smash ‘Pretty Boy Swag’ is the credited sample in ‘Wanna Be,’ was named a co-defendant.Megan Thee Stallion shows off her curvy figure in a green and blue string bikini (Video)

At the time of this report, the financial remedy Washington seeks for the alleged unauthorized use of his song has not been openly disclosed.
